Hallo zusammen,
Ich habe das Problem im Project Modul einem Projekt Teilprojekte bzw. Tasks zuzuweisen. Szenarion 1: Wenn ich im übergeordneten Projekt unter Children das untergeordnete Projekt angebe kommt die Meldung “There should be only one timesheet work by task/project.” -> Ich habe für jeden Task und jedes Projekt ein eigenes „Timesheet Works“ angelegt. Gibt es hier ein anderes Vorgehen? Szenario 2: Wenn ich im untergeordneten Projekt unter Parent das übergeordnete Projekt angebe kommt keine Warnung/Fehler. Wenn ich nun allerdings das übergeordnete Projekt nach dem Speichern öffne kommt folgende Fehlermeldung: Traceback (most recent call last): File "\trytond\protocols\jsonrpc.py", line 162, in _marshaled_dispatch response['result'] = dispatch_method(method, params) File "\trytond\protocols\jsonrpc.py", line 191, in _dispatch res = dispatch(*args) File "\trytond\protocols\dispatcher.py", line 158, in dispatch result = rpc.result(meth(*c_args, **c_kwargs)) File "\trytond\model\modelsql.py", line 663, in read getter_results = field.get(ids, cls, field_list, values=result) File "\trytond\model\fields\function.py", line 91, in get return call(names) File "\trytond\model\fields\function.py", line 84, in call return method(records, name) File "\trytond\modules\project_plan\work.py", line 129, in get_function_fields durations[work.parent.id] += durations[work_id] TypeError: unsupported operand type(s) for +=: 'NoneType' and 'NoneType' Verwende Tryton 3.6 und Windows 7 mit PostgreSQL Datenbank. Unter bugs.tryton.org habe ich leider nichts gefunden.. Ich hoffe, dass ich mich verständlich ausgedrückt habe und hoffe auf eure Hilfe. Viele Grüße Dan -- Sie erhalten diese Nachricht, weil Sie Mitglied der Google Groups-Gruppe "tryton-de" sind. Weitere Optionen: https://groups.google.com/d/optout